Remove specific strings from raw events based on other fields

sandeepreddy947
Path Finder

Firewall logs needs some purification for threat monitoring, below are couple events, 

From the events below action=Accept AND Service=23 along with protection_type=geo_protection, we need "protection_type=geo_protection" to be removed from raw in indextime extraction.

Use SEDCMD in props.conf

[mysourcetype]
SEDCMD-rm-geo_protection = s/protection_type=geo_protection/---/g

But, this regex with SED will replace in all events, i only need them replaced when action=Allowed and Service=23" in raw events. your regex will not satisfy below event.

Sorry about that.  Try this SEDCMD, instead.  It does, however, make some assumptions about the order of fields.

SEDCMD-rm-geo_protection = s/(.*\|action=Accept\|)(.*?)\|protection_type=geo_protection\|(.*?)(\|service=23.*)/\1\2|---|\3\4/
